Output 39e7962798de061c5f96475769e1dd8d95c2c9f1095bae9d8a5c5a5132980646:1

value
20747188
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95a5bf77f0a48613272b39c4e46be1a1f5c28cca OP_EQUALVERIFY OP_CHECKSIG
address
1EeGEx85WgrN3ExZGLwpbVU5qvCCr96VCU
transaction
39e7962798de061c5f96475769e1dd8d95c2c9f1095bae9d8a5c5a5132980646
spent
true